Monte Pissis is a major high-altitude mountain, reaching an elevation of 6,795 meters (22,293 feet) above sea level. It is located in Argentina, part of the Andes mountain range. This mountain requires advanced mountaineering skills and proper high-altitude preparation. The Andes form the longest continental mountain range in the world. With a prominence of 2,145 meters, Monte Pissis rises significantly above its surroundings. Coordinates: -27.7553, -68.7992.
